Why is this Role Essential?
Concerto is seeking a Dialysis Nurse Float to join its team! As a Floater, the Dialysis Nurse is not assigned to one facility and is expected to travel across the Region as needed to fill in for staff on vacation or leave. The Dialysis Nurse supervises dialysis care in accordance with policy, procedure and training and in compliance with state and federal regulations. Assures responsibility for the unit and works collaboratively with members of the hemodialysis healthcare team. Supervises care given by dialysis technicians while
assuming a ‘hands on’ role and fostering a team approach to patient care.
What Will You Do?
1. Patient Care & Education
Provides direct hemodialysis care, performs assessments, administers medications, and educates
patients on renal health, treatment, and self-care.
2. Team Leadership & Supervision
Delegates tasks to dialysis technicians, supervises their performance, and ensures compliance
with clinical standards and regulations.
3. Treatment Monitoring & Adjustment
Monitors patient response to dialysis, adjusts treatment plans as needed, and ensures accurate
documentation of interventions and outcomes.
4. Collaboration & Communication
Works closely with physicians and healthcare team members to coordinate care, report critical lab
results, and ensure continuity of treatment.
5. Documentation & Compliance
Maintains accurate electronic medical records, ensures timely completion of care plans, and
adheres to safety and regulatory protocols.

What’s Required?
▪ Graduate of an accredited school of Nursing
▪ Current State appropriate or Compact RN License
▪ Minimum of one (1) year of nursing experience in any practice area
▪ Minimum of three (3) months of Dialysis experience required
▪ BLS Provider certification
▪ Reliable transportation
Physical Requirements & Work Environment
This role requires successful completion of the Ishihara Color Blindness Test to ensure accurate color
perception in a clinical setting. It also involves prolonged walking, standing, stooping, and bending, with
the ability to lift up to 25 lbs. Strong focus and attention to detail are essential. The work environment
includes temperature control, moderate noise levels, and potential exposure to infectious materials.
